Anbruch der Neuen Zeit: Das Dramatische 16. Jahrhundert

Marina Munkler

Reformation, printing, the price revolution and the Ottoman frontier, analysed from a Central European vantage point rather than the usual Atlantic one.

Munkler gives an analytical history of a century that set the stage for most of what followed, taking in the Reformation, printing, the price revolution and the Ottoman frontier. The centre of gravity is Central European rather than Atlantic, and that shift changes which developments end up looking decisive and which look incidental.

Tyler Cowen

An excellent analytical overview of the 16th century, which of course is what set the stage for so much of what was to follow. Not surprisingly, has more of a Central European emphasis than many Anglo works on the same period.
